The Baiyoke Sky Hotel is an 84 Storied Hotel located right in the middle of the busy Pratunam Shopping Area, right next to the Popular Indra Market in Bangkok. It is reported to be the Tallest Hotel & Building in Thailand and is just 150 meters away from the Ratchaprarop ARL (Airport Rail Link) Express Metro Station from where you can easily walk even with your Luggage to the Hotel. The Hotel offers a Complimentary Shared Coach Drop to the ARL Station and a few other Popular Places every hour during the day, which is really good. The Lobby is on the 18th Floor and the Hotel has 658 Spacious Rooms of three types – Standard Zone from 22nd to 49th floor, Sky Zone from 50th to 68th floor and Space Zone from 70th to 74th floor. They have an International Buffet Breakfast served at 3 Locations - the Bangkok Balcony on the 81st Floor (with an Open Air Section as well which offers Absolutely Fantastic Views of the City of Bangkok), Stella Palace on the 79th Floor and Bangkok Sky Restaurant on the 78th Floor. The spread is the same at all 3 Locations and is Really Massive with Cuisines from all over the World and Several Live Counters as well. The Hotel also has several other Amenities – Baiyoke Mini Golf Course and Tee Off Café on the 18th Floor, a Large, Well Maintained Swimming Pool, Fitness Club, & Spa on the 20th Floor, Sky Relax Massage on the 69th Floor, Observation Deck on the 77th Floor, Roof Top Bar on the 83rd Floor and Revolving View Point on the 84th Floor. They also have International and Sea Food Lunch and Dinner Buffets at their various Restaurants located from the 78th Floor to the 83rd Floor, which not only offer Delicious Food, but also offer Spectacular Views and a Fantastic Ambience to dine at.
